Beirut, Lebanon - Located on the Mediterranean coast at the foot of the Lebanon Mountains, Beirut is the capital and largest city of Lebanon. In the 1960s, the city was nicknamed the “Paris of the Middle East,” after it became a popular tourist destination known for its glamorous lifestyle, intellectual life, and cultural opportunities. The city was lined with waterfront bars and cafes that wouldn’t look out of place in the City of Light. However, when civil war broke out in 1975, Beirut tragically suffered its scars, including prolonged economic wounds. Despite this, the city continues to rebuild itself and hopes to establish its tourism industry once again.:
